How does a motor function

The motor is the main component of every treadmill. It moves the belt, allowing you to run, walk or jog. It's also the main part of the machine and plays a major part in its performance and durability. Understanding how motors operate is essential for making an informed decision.

There are two primary kinds of treadmill motors: DC and AC. Both have their own unique advantages and disadvantages, yet they function in a similar manner. DC motors are employed in robotics and electric shock-absorbing treadmill vehicles in addition to many other applications. They are highly efficient durable, long-lasting, and easy to control. AC motors are used in commercial fitness equipment like treadmills. DC motors are less expensive but AC motors have higher performance and have longer lifespan.

Motor size

When you're shopping for a new treadmill, the motor size can be a confusing element of the specifications. It's crucial to understand that bigger isn't always better, you must also understand what the horsepower specification is for your exercise.

One of the most common misconceptions is that people think the peak horsepower (PHP) rating on treadmills is an electric treadmill better than a manual equal to the quality of the treadmill. This isn't true because the treadmill's maximum power will only last for a brief time before the motor's lifespan is reached. Continuous horsepower (CHP) is an accurate measurement, which measures the amount of power that a treadmill motor can produce indefinitely.

The motor's RPM is another important aspect to consider. This reflects how many revolutions the motor is able to make in a minute, which is an indication of its power and ability to run the belt smoothly. Low RPM ratings can lead to delays and interruptions in the speed of the belt which can adversely affect the treadmill experience.

There are two kinds of treadmill motors: DC and AC. AC motors are usually used in gyms for commercial use, are better suited for high-use environments. DC motors tend to be utilized in home fitness equipment. DC motors operate by using direct current electricity to create a magnetic field, that interacts with permanent magnets in the motor, causing it to move.

If you're in search of a more durable treadmill motor, it's best small electric treadmill to go with an AC motor. AC motors are more robust and can stand up to the wear and tear of repeated use throughout the day. AC motors are also less likely to overheat than DC motors. However, if you're shopping on a budget there are still high-quality treadmills with DC motors that will serve your fitness needs effectively.

Maintenance of the motor

As with any product, a treadmill motor's integrity will eventually degrade. You can prolong the life of your treadmill by adhering to a regular maintenance routine and paying attention to warning signs. Strange sounds, overheated burning smells, and malfunctioning control of incline and speed are a few warning signs. These warnings should be taken seriously and acted on immediately.

Treadmill motor service might seem daunting at first, however, it's actually easy. Begin by disconnecting the treadmill and then removing the motor cover. You can then make use of a multimeter to test for electrical problems. You should be able to remove any dust, hair or other debris that has built up inside the motor. This will ensure that the motor operates efficiently and doesn't get damaged too soon.
